Preserve and restore x and y origin of editor viewport in Editor state.

Clean up Editor's update of various things by:
1. merging Editor's handlers of SuperRapidScreenUpdate.
2. separating out work to be done on this update and work to be done
   on a locate.
Hopefully easier to understand this way.
